Optimization of Kinoform Lenses with the Monte Carlo Method
Applied Optics, Vol. 37, Issue 17, pp. 3685-3688 (1998)
http://dx.doi.org/10.1364/AO.37.003685
Acrobat PDF (358 KB)
Abstract
For the optimization of non-Fourier-type computer-generated phase holograms (kinoform lenses), a method based on the Monte Carlo procedure is suggested. This method can be regarded as analogous to the iterative Fourier transform algorithm method that is widely used for the optimization of Fourier-type computer-generated phase holograms (kinoforms).
